Engineering Team LeadGreenix is looking for an Engineering Team Lead to own our ecommerce and web platform and to set technical direction for a small, high-leverage development team. You'll be hands-on — architecting, building, and maintaining the ecomm/web platform yourself — while also directing the work of a junior engineer focused on backend and data projects and coordinating with an external contractor building our AI/agent enablement tools (MCP servers, agent workflows).This is a working technical lead role: most of your week is still spent writing code and solving problems directly, but you're also the person who decides what the team works on next and reviews how it gets built.Essential Duties and Responsibilities:Own the architecture, development, and ongoing maintenance of Greenix's ecommerce platform and websiteDrive improvements in site performance, technical SEO, and conversion-relevant metrics, using analytics (Google Analytics or similar) to inform decisionsOwn project intake and prioritization for the development team's backlog, directing the day-to-day work of a junior engineer and an external AI/agent enablement contractorReview code and provide technical guidance to the junior engineer, raising the bar on engineering standards across backend and data-focused projectsCoordinate with the external contractor on AI/agent and MCP server initiatives, ensuring their work aligns with the broader platform and prioritiesApply DevOps practices across CI/CD, deployment, and infrastructure for web/ecomm systems, partnering closely with your manager (Systems, InfoSec & Infrastructure) on security and infrastructure standardsWork full-stack as needed — front-end, back-end, integrations — to keep the ecomm/web roadmap movingHelp guide the platform toward an API-first architecture, where front-end experiences are built on top of well-defined APIs.Help shape AI Development Practices for the company.Qualifications:~5 years of experience in software engineering, with a strong track record on ecommerce platforms (having supported or built multiple ecomm sites is a big plus)Full-stack development experience across modern front-end and back-end technologiesWorking knowledge of SEO fundamentals and web analytics tools (Google Analytics or equivalent)Practical DevOps experience — CI/CD, deployment pipelines, infrastructure-as-code, or similarExperience directing the work of other engineers or contractors — setting priorities, reviewing output — without necessarily having held a formal management titleStrong communication skills; comfortable setting technical direction and prioritizing work for a small teamHands-on experience with HTML, CSS, and JavaScript, plus experience with React, Angular, or a similar front-end frameworkCompliance Considerations:ADA Accommodations: Reasonable accommodation will be provided to enable individuals with disabilities to perform essential functions.Regulatory Requirements: Must comply with applicable state and federal employment laws.
